> We want to abandon the Etoys code fork. At some point in the future, we
> want to build an Etoys release from a Trunk image.
>
> So "which of Etoys"? All that is needed to load and use current Etoys
> projects nicely. A trunk-based Etoys release would need to work at least as
> well as the previous versions (and will hopefully be better).
>
> It doesn't have to work exactly the same, though. It should be cleaner and
> faster :)
>
> As for GetText, maybe the best would be to not have this in a separate
> package. At the very least we need to move Locale etc. back into the
> "System" package. In Etoys, GetText had 7 classes, in Trunk you made it 15.
> The idea was to have NaturalLanguageTranslator as abstract superclass for
> translation services, and have the old InternalTranslator and the new
> GetTextTranslator as concrete subclasses.
>
> We need to decide if keeping the old InternalTranslator around is
> necessary. I don't know anyone who is using it, so my suggestion would be
> to discard it.

> Here is my break-down of the classes currently in your GetText package:
>
> System
>        Locale - move back to System pkg
>        LocaleID - move back to System pkg
>        ISOLanguageDefinition - move back to System pkg
>
> Translation core (needed at runtime)
>        NaturalLanguageTranslator - abstract superclass
>        NaturalLanguageFormTranslator - for translatable bitmaps
>        GetTextTranslator - looks up translation in MO file
>        MOFile - parses MO files
>        TextDomainManager - needed at runtime
>
> Utilities (not needed at runtime)
>        GetTextExporter: collects strings from image and writes out POT
> files
>        TranslatedReceiverFinder - needed by exporter
>        GetTextInterchange - superclass for importer
>        GetTextImporter - loads PO files, only used by exporter and editor
>        LanguageEditor - interface for editing translations (not currently
> used, but may be useful)
>        GetTextExporter2 - delete (I wonder why is this back?)
>
> Here's the current sizes:
>
> {NaturalLanguageTranslator. NaturalLanguageFormTranslator.
> GetTextTranslator. MOFile. TextDomainManager} collect: #linesOfCode
> ==> #(418 49 135 223 60)
>
> {GetTextExporter. TranslatedReceiverFinder. GetTextInterchange.
> GetTextImporter. LanguageEditor} collect: #linesOfCode
> ==> #(408 190 8 163 1073)
>
> The Locale classes need to move back to the System package. My suggestion
> would be to move the "Translation core" classes into the System package as
> well, and keep only the "Utilities" in the GetText package, which then can
> easily be unloaded.
